What Is a 180 Day Calculator?

A 180 day calculator finds the calendar date exactly 180 days before or after a start date. It is useful for half-year milestones, immigration and visa deadlines, academic terms, warranty periods, and long-range project planning.

Example

Starting January 1, 2024 and adding 180 days gives June 29, 2024 (2024 is a leap year). Subtracting 180 days from December 31, 2024 gives July 4, 2024.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is 180 days the same as six months?

Not exactly. Six calendar months depend on which months are involved, while 180 days is always 180 calendar days. Use the 6 Month Calculator for calendar-month arithmetic.

Does the calculator handle leap years?

Yes. Leap days and varying month lengths are handled automatically when the 180-day span crosses February.
